The Indian Premier League (IPL) is known as much for its sporting and glamour quotient as for its controversies. Let's take a look at the controversies that hit the cash-rich league since its inception:
The latest controversy to hit the tourney is the ban on the cricketers from the island nation from playing in Chennai after Tamil Nadu Chief Minister J. Jayalalithaa insisted that the matches can be played in the southern metropolis only if there were no players or team officials from the Emerald Island.The IPL's unilateral decision did not go down well with the team owners and now the franchises with a strong Sri Lankan presence are slowly building up pressure on the IPL Governing Council to shift their play-off and knockout matches out of Chennai.

The Enforcement Directorate (ED) recently slapped a penalty notice of approximately Rs 100 crore against IPL team Rajasthan Royals. The penalty order said the probe agency found that foreign investment in Jaipur IPL Cricket Private Limited (JIPL) was made in "flagrant contravention of FEMA" and the investment made in this regard was made "much prior to the incorporation of JIPL".

Also, match-fixing allegations surfaced last year after a sting operation conducted by a news channel claimed to have uncovered shady deals between team owners, players and management. Five players were suspended by the league. The players who got suspended were Abhinav Bali, TP Sudhindra (Deccan Chargers), Mohnish Mishra (Pune Warriors), Amit Yadav (Kings XI Punjab) and Shalabh Shrivastava (Kings XI Punjab). (Getty Images)

Continuing the controversy trail, Pune Warriors India players Rahul Sharma and Wayne Pernell were tested positive for consumption of drugs at a rave party in Mumbai last year.
